From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.ffmpeg.org (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TPS id B838D4BC09 for ; Wed, 23 Jul 2025 17:50:57 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.ffmpeg.org (Postfix) with ESMTP id 519A668CEB8; Wed, 23 Jul 2025 20:50:54 +0300 (EEST) Received: from mail-yb1-f171.google.com (mail-yb1-f171.google.com [209.85.219.171]) by ffbox0-bg.ffmpeg.org (Postfix) with ESMTPS id E803868C698 for ; Wed, 23 Jul 2025 20:50:47 +0300 (EEST) Received: by mail-yb1-f171.google.com with SMTP id 3f1490d57ef6-e8d707b9bc2so62011276.3 for ; Wed, 23 Jul 2025 10:50:47 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1753293046; x=1753897846;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=NGoER4KTbe/bQX+mEIcD+8Tr7kCEjt8XI1DEMdA4bCM=; b=ZSaUAZzLR+yAWspZ/pfSBJDg5bKTsd+hdXRzKsU8HNPdNaLSuxKyiIKb7qlNiM5dHc 4JarXANpQBS6IX32m3rFNNB4drM/J9Ebzq46gh5PALBqXoFDU8SwopMh8l0WOKNz0AlJ +C6I2LarmVaNd6LpAX98Z49bKgTBXiJe07s8+SFGxnAZDVdEpkgnMQSUwLndlQ5gr1Wq sV646grKfGOURaZyj+mfRWCIB/Lfam9WCAbW+x4Hdtjp+ZWIYtR0HS/Ze7NYNov7Buj7 2g0fdkxD30E+VJ+AVwNttF/j5iYxF664sJ4aFXkBVz2sQnfQIDK156dctBy25x2rcrI6 c3pA== X-Gm-Message-State: AOJu0YwY4P64JpH2rCT/Kp6n87YTBBna6DnuHeDc61//PzEVxKWghKJa UE4DUS/yir4PAzjhEqsWSwm8Ps8Q6t2/qzkin0wzsN3Kpk25dj1DBlrMNIECey6OsAD/bvNetN1 XM4S88dI2vHvH8MKmTZ0SRba0Jx32icV1WHzp+TKzzhNqPWj2oGGHAms= X-Gm-Gg: ASbGncvMBfMVKdN4eGYZpOJz0hsg3Gfusn4ioEZ8M49Z14Z14M7abEQJWEhE0xt+eUW rHZAQTexabj6iRJvTc1Q25NiNJ5s/HbSmgPDkroXL89jJEqYpvDlblDv1Ab1d9jtFbUKXZQM9nE 9bSSdcUBsbIBPcTf5hu7pemCrBxKGPYnCCYJi1QT0j9qtJzwVLdStk/2zvmZYckiiwSdpkTLVNc HfgKo0MP5hscUPiGQ== X-Google-Smtp-Source: AGHT+IEJP7r8nfj0RtvKO4ajhw/yTG1WuQYzgYM3sJhgLhu54J0AbPDqTNrojjiMMexPmBNVXpyximdQA2TrIcmLCYE= X-Received: by 2002:a05:690c:6105:b0:714:583:6d05 with SMTP id 00721157ae682-719b4336755mr50605797b3.32.1753293045913; Wed, 23 Jul 2025 10:50:45 -0700 (PDT) MIME-Version: 1.0 References: In-Reply-To: Date: Wed, 23 Jul 2025 13:50:33 -0400 X-Gm-Features: Ac12FXwGbFwk35RGl6-yj9yf2gH-b7-7SsoNs520viYKQzauGL-z9Wwi6HHVjXY Message-ID: To: FFmpeg development discussions and patches Subject: Re: [FFmpeg-devel] [PATCH] avformat/demux: avoid unconditional ID3v2 tag consumption X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, From: Nil Fons Miret via ffmpeg-devel Reply-To: FFmpeg development discussions and patches Cc: Nil Fons Miret , Kyle Swanson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Archived-At: List-Archive: List-Post: SGksCgpQaW5naW5nIHRoaXMgcGF0Y2ggZnJvbSBhIGNvdXBsZSB3ZWVrcyBhZ28uIFRvIGJlIGNs ZWFyLCBJIGFtIG5vdCBzdXJlCmhvdyBwZW9wbGUgdHlwaWNhbGx5IHVzZSBmZm1wZWcncyBJRDN2 MiBzdXBwb3J0LCBzbyBwbGVhc2UgbGV0IG1lIGtub3cKaWYgdGhlIHBhdGNoIGlzIG1pc3Npbmcg c29tZXRoaW5nIGFuZCBJJ20gaGFwcHkgdG8gaXRlcmF0ZSBvbiBpdCwgYnV0Cml0IGRvZXMgc2Vl bSB0byBtZSB0aGF0IHRyeWluZyB0byBwYXJzZSBpdCBmcm9tIHJhd3ZpZGVvIGlucHV0cyBpcwp3 cm9uZy4KClRoYW5rIHlvdSwKTmlsCgpPbiBUdWUsIEp1bCA4LCAyMDI1IGF0IDY6MDfigK9QTSBO aWwgRm9ucyBNaXJldCA8bmlsZkBuZXRmbGl4LmNvbT4gd3JvdGU6Cj4KPiBJIGhhdmUgZm91bmQg YSBmZXcgaW5zdGFuY2VzIG9mIHJhd3ZpZGVvIGZpbGVzIHRoYXQgY29pbmNpZGVudGFsbHkKPiBz dGFydCB3aXRoIGEgaGVhZGVyIG1hdGNoaW5nIHRoZSBJRDN2MiBoZWFkZXIgZm9ybWF0LCBhbmQg ZmZtcGVnCj4gY29uc3VtZXMgdGhlIGhlYWRlciBiZWZvcmUgZGVtdXhpbmcsIGNhdXNpbmcgYSBk ZWNvZGluZyBlcnJvci4gVGhpcwo+IGhhcHBlbnMgZXZlbiBpZiAiLWYgcmF3dmlkZW8iIGlzIHNw ZWNpZmllZC4KPgo+IFRoaXMgcGF0Y2ggbGltaXRzIHRoZSBmb3JtYXRzIGZvciB3aGljaCB0aGlz IGF1dG9tYXRpYyBjb25zdW1pbmcgb2YKPiBJRDN2MiBoZWFkZXJzIGlzIGRvbmUuIE5vdGU6IEkg YW0gbm90IGFuIGV4cGVydCBpbiBJRDN2MiBieSBhbnkgbWVhbnMsCj4gYW5kIEknbSBoYXBweSB0 byBhY2NlcHQgc3VnZ2VzdGlvbnMsIGJvdGggb24gdGhlIHNjb3BlIGFuZCBtZWNoYW5pc20KPiBv ZiB0aGUgc29sdXRpb24uCj4KPiBUbyByZXByb2R1Y2UsIHlvdSBjYW4gZWFzaWx5IGdlbmVyYXRl IGFuIGV4YW1wbGUgYXMgZm9sbG93czoKPgo+IGBgYAo+ICggIGVjaG8gIjQ5IDQ0IDMzIDJCIDk4 IDNBIDQ5IDQ0IDMzIDJCIDk4IDNBIDZBIDQ0IDU0IDJCIiB8IHh4ZCAtciAtcAo+ICAgZGQgaWY9 L2Rldi96ZXJvIGJzPTEgY291bnQ9MTE1MTg0IDI+L2Rldi9udWxsCj4gKSA+IGlkM3YyXzMyMHgy NDBfeXV2NDIwcC55dXYKPgo+Cj4gZmZtcGVnIC1mIHJhd3ZpZGVvIC1zIDMyMHgyNDAgLXBpeF9m bXQgeXV2NDIwcCAtaQo+IGlkM3YyXzMyMHgyNDBfeXV2NDIwcC55dXYgLWYgbnVsbCAtCj4gYGBg Cj4KPiBUaGlzIGdlbmVyYXRlcyBhIDMyMHgyNDAgeXV2NDIwcCBmaWxlIHdpdGggYSAxNi1ieXRl IGhlYWRlciB0aGF0Cj4gbWF0Y2hlcyB0aGUgSUQzdjIgaGVhZGVyIGZvcm1hdCAodGhpcyB3YXMg Y29waWVkIGZyb20gYSByZWFsIGNhc2UgSQo+IHNhdykgYW5kIGNvbXBsZXRlZCB3aXRoIHplcm9l cyBmb3IgYSB0b3RhbCBvZiAxMTUyMDAgYnl0ZXMsIHRoZSByaWdodAo+IHNpemUgZm9yIHRoaXMg cmVzb2x1dGlvbiBhbmQgcGl4ZWwgZm9ybWF0Lgo+Cj4gT24gdGhlIG1hc3RlciBicmFuY2gsIEkg c2VlOgo+IGBgYAo+IFsuLi5dCj4gSUQzdjIuNDMgdGFnIHNraXBwZWQsIGNhbm5vdCBoYW5kbGUg dmVyc2lvbgo+IFsuLi5dCj4gW291dCMwL251bGwgQCAweDE1NzAwYTZlMF0gT3V0cHV0IGZpbGUg aXMgZW1wdHksIG5vdGhpbmcgd2FzCj4gZW5jb2RlZChjaGVjayAtc3MgLyAtdCAvIC1mcmFtZXMg cGFyYW1ldGVycyBpZiB1c2VkKQo+IGZyYW1lPSAgICAwIGZwcz0wLjAgcT0wLjAgTHNpemU9Ti9B IHRpbWU9Ti9BIGJpdHJhdGU9Ti9BIHNwZWVkPU4vQQo+IGBgYAo+Cj4gQWZ0ZXIgdGhlIGNoYW5n ZXM6IGl0IGRlY29kZXMgYXMgZXhwZWN0ZWQuCj4gYGBgCj4gWy4uLl0KPiBmcmFtZT0gICAgMSBm cHM9MC4wIHE9LTAuMCBMc2l6ZT1OL0EgdGltZT0wMDowMDowMC4wNCBiaXRyYXRlPU4vQQo+IHNw ZWVkPTE2LjV4IGVsYXBzZWQ9MDowMDowMC4wMAo+IGBgYAo+Cj4gVGhhbmtzIGluIGFkdmFuY2Us Cj4gTmlsC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CmZm bXBlZy1kZXZlbCBtYWlsaW5nIGxpc3QKZmZtcGVnLWRldmVsQGZmbXBlZy5vcmcKaHR0cHM6Ly9m Zm1wZWcub3JnL21haWxtYW4vbGlzdGluZm8vZmZtcGVnLWRldmVsCgpUbyB1bnN1YnNjcmliZSwg dmlzaXQgbGluayBhYm92ZSwgb3IgZW1haWwKZmZtcGVnLWRldmVsLXJlcXVlc3RAZmZtcGVnLm9y ZyB3aXRoIHN1YmplY3QgInVuc3Vic2NyaWJlIi4K